Rewinding to 1982, E.T. ruled the box office, and Michael Jackson's Thriller ascended to the top of the pop charts. Meanwhile, Tom Scholz of Boston fame designed and debuted the Rockman X100, a headphone amplifier with built-in effects and studio-magic capabilities that would go on to define the guitar-driven, chorus-laden sound of 1980s arena rock. Scholz, an MIT-schooled engineer, had spent countless hours experimenting with guitars, amplifiers, and effects, which resulted in "The Boston Tone" and, ultimately, his line of Rockman gear. Fast-forward to 2025, MXR has harnessed the same vitality, technology, and mystical sonic power of the original Rockman X100 in a new, compact, and dynamic stompbox preamp pedal. The Rockman X100 pedal features four distinct preset modes — two clean and two dirty — that, with the help of a complicated compression circuit, capture the same shimmering cleans and distorted depths of the original presets. To further tailor your levels and complement the dynamics of the preset modes, the Rockman X100 includes Volume and Input Gain sliders that allow you to directly control how your incoming signal interacts with both the preamp and your amplifier, ensuring a precisely dialed-in tone. Lastly, the Rockman X100 comes equipped with the same MN3007 bucket brigade chip found in the classic model. Indeed, guitarists have discovered a sea of sprawling, shimmering chorus, all available with the simple push of a button. The original Rockman X100 helped shape a guitar tone that inspired players throughout the '80s and beyond; the redefined Rockman X100 from MXR is poised to carry that flag forward and continue to inspire generations of guitar players for decades to come.
